THE GREAT SPHINX, as you may remember, is something around the Giza pyramids in Egypt. Yes, the human head and the lion body. But did you know that, it is not the way it always seemed like. Discovering the great sphinx actually happened over a span of years.

To start somewhere with, this is how the Great Sphinx looked in 1857, before it was excavated. The famous sculpture was buried in the sands, surrounded by a series of mysteries that remain unsolved to this day.

image.png
Source

The Sphinx was discovered in the early 19th century, but initially, only the top of its head was visible, with much of it buried under the sand.
